The fan control on my 2003 LX has quit working. It's completely off on 0, 1, 2, and 3, but it works if it's on 4. The weird thing, though, is that if I have the A/C on, it works if I have the fan set at 1, 2, or 3, but if I turn the fan to 4, which is the only setting on which the fan works, the A/C shuts off. So...what ends up happening is that I get cold air that barely comes out of the vents, or I get warm air (whatever the temp is outside) blown at me at full blast. Anyone know what I need to do to fix this? I don't want to take it to a dealer to have it fixed. Do I just need to replace the HVAC controls?

Hey breiland
I had to fix this as well right after I bought my Mazdaspeed Protege.
It goes by the names of Blower Motor Relay, Blow Motor Fuse, Heater Motor Relay, etc.
Its about 36 bucks from a Mazda dealership. I had no luck finding it at any parts store. Took about a week to come in as well.
The part is located behind the glovebox in the 03.5 MSP, I would assume its in the same place on the 03 LX.

Pull out the glove compartment. (Open it, squeeze the sides, and pull it the rest of the way out.)
Behind the glove compartment, you'll see a white plug. Unplug it, and undo the two screws holding the voltage resistor (I think that's what it's called.) in place. It'll be a black plastic piece with a red plate-looking-thing sticking out of it. This is what you need to replace. I got mine from my Mazda dealership's parts department for around $35 including tax. You don't need to replace the fan switch or the control box. Let me know if you have any other questions.
